How Salesforce Manages Nonprofit Programs & Services

Nonprofit programs and services can be effectively tracked and managed using Salesforce by leveraging its powerful features and tools. Here are four key ways to achieve this:

Program Management with Custom Objects and Fields

  • Custom Objects: Create custom objects to represent different programs and services. This allows you to track specific details about each program, such as goals, activities, and outcomes.
  • Custom Fields: Add custom fields to capture relevant information for each program, such as start and end dates, budgets, participant demographics, and impact metrics.

Grant and Donation Tracking

  • Opportunity Management: Use the Opportunities object to track grants and donations tied to specific programs. This helps in managing funding sources, tracking progress against fundraising goals, and understanding the financial health of each program.
  • Grant Management Apps: Implement grant management solutions available on the Salesforce AppExchange to streamline the application, approval, and reporting processes for grants.

Volunteer and Participant Management

  • Volunteer Management: Utilize volunteer management tools within Salesforce, such as Volunteers for Salesforce, to track volunteer activities, schedules, and hours related to programs and services.
  • Participant Tracking: Use custom objects or the NPSP’s built-in functionality to track participants in your programs. Capture details such as attendance, progress, and outcomes to evaluate the effectiveness of your services.

Reporting and Dashboards

  • Custom Reports: Create custom reports to analyze program performance, participant outcomes, and financials. Use these reports to measure impact, identify trends, and make data-driven decisions.
  • Dashboards: Build dashboards to visualize key metrics and track the progress of your programs in real-time. Dashboards can display information such as the number of participants served, funds raised, volunteer hours contributed, and program outcomes.
  • Reporting Tools: Use Salesforce’s reporting tools to track and measure the impact of your programs and services. This can include metrics like the number of beneficiaries, success stories, and overall community impact.
